What's the best time of year to book my B&B in Maca?
When you're planning your escape to Maca, make sure that you take the year-round temperatures into account. The hottest months are usually September and October,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are June and July, with an average of 12°C. The rainiest months in Maca are February, January, March and December, with each month seeing an average of 182 mm of rainfall.
What is there to do in Maca?
Spend some time exploring Cerro Hornillo and Cerro Quenuarane if you're hoping to see some of the area's natural features. You might also consider a trip to sites such as Uyu Uyu or Condor's Cross if you have time to see more of the area.
